You’re keen to scrape data from Yelp, but you’re stuck. Don’t worry! This article is your guide. We’ll explain why proxies are vital, how they work, and which ones suit Yelp best. You’ll learn step-by-step techniques and overcome common challenges. By ProxyEmpire
→ Discover our:
→ Visit our blog and discover our different articles:
⇒ And more!
- Proxies are crucial for safe and efficient data scraping from Yelp.
- Proxies help avoid IP blocks and ensure uninterrupted scraping workflow.
- Using reliable proxies enhances data privacy and protects against prying eyes.
- Proxy servers speed up scraping, leading to enhanced productivity and reduced blocking risk.
Understanding Proxies and Their Role in Data Scraping
You’ve got to understand that proxies play a crucial role in data scraping from Yelp. They act as intermediaries and provide anonymity. Think of them as your cloaking device, keeping your identity hidden while you scrape valuable data.
They allow you to bypass restrictions and access information without being detected or blocked. Remember, Yelp doesn’t appreciate bots crawling its site for data extraction. If they catch you, they’ll block your IP address quicker than you can say ‘proxy.’
That’s where these handy tools come into play. Proxies mask your real IP with a different one each time you send a request to Yelp’s server. So if you’re serious about scraping data from Yelp safely and efficiently, don’t underestimate the power of using proxies.
The Importance of Proxies for Yelp Data Scraping
You’re about to dive into the importance of using proxies when scraping Yelp data.
We’ll discuss how they can help you avoid IP blocks, enhance your data privacy, and significantly speed up your scraping process.
It’s all about making your data collection more efficient and secure!
Avoiding IP Blocks
To avoid IP blocks, you must use proxies when scraping data from Yelp. Proxies help in masking your IP address and avoiding detection by the website’s security systems. If you’re not using proxies, your activity might be flagged as suspicious and result in an IP block.
Here’s a simple comparison to explain:
|Without Proxy||With Proxy|
|Your real IP is exposed||Your real IP is hidden|
|High risk of getting blocked||Low risk of getting blocked|
|A limited number of requests||Unlimited number of requests|
Enhancing Data Privacy
In enhancing your privacy, it’s paramount that you employ encryption and anonymization techniques. You’re not just protecting your data from prying eyes, but also ensuring its integrity. Here are three key steps to remember:
- Use reliable proxies: Choose from the best in the market to ensure your IP address isn’t exposed during your scraping activities.
- Employ strong encryption methods: Don’t compromise on this as weak encryption can easily be broken into, leaving your data exposed.
- Anonymize yourself online: Masking your identity is essential to avoid being traced back.
Speeding Up Scraping
Let’s now focus on how to speed up your scraping process without compromising the quality of information gathered. You’re probably thinking, “How can I get more data in less time?” Here’s where proxies come into play.
A proxy server acts as an intermediary between your computer and the website you’re scraping. It’s like having a digital disguise that helps you avoid detection and therefore, blocking. Using multiple proxies will allow you to send more requests per minute, hence speeding up your scraping process significantly.
|Faster Data Scraping||Empowered||Enhanced Productivity|
|Reduced Blocking Risk||Secure||Uninterrupted Workflow|
|Increased Anonymity||Confident||Worry-Free Operations|
|Broad Geo-Location Access||Adventurous||Global Reach|
|More Efficient Use of Time||Satisfied||Higher ROI|
Types of Proxies Suitable for Yelp
Residential and data center proxies are typically the most suitable for scraping data from Yelp. They’re reliable, fast, and less likely to get you blocked.
But it’s not just about choosing any proxy. There are three things you should consider:
- Reliability: You need a proxy that won’t fail you in the middle of your work. Nothing can be more frustrating than a job half-done.
- Speed: Time is money, friend! A slow proxy will not only test your patience but also cost you valuable time.
- Anonymity: Always protect your identity while scraping data; it’s essential to avoid IP bans or potential legal issues.
Detailed Steps to Use Proxies for Yelp Scraping
Now we’ll dive into the specifics of setting up your anonymization process for gathering information online.
First, choose a reliable proxy service provider. They’ll provide you with multiple IP addresses to keep your activities discreet.
Next, configure these proxies with your scraper software. This can usually be done in the settings menu.
You’ll also want to set intervals between requests because Yelp can detect rapid-fire activity and block you. Using rotating proxies is another smart move – they switch IPs after every request, making detection even harder.
Overcoming Common Challenges in Yelp Data Scraping
You’ve mastered the basics of Yelp data scraping, but are you ready to take on the more advanced challenges?
In our next discussion, we’ll delve into how you can navigate through Yelp’s anti-scraping measures and keep your data collection efforts undisrupted.
Plus, we’re going to share tips on optimizing your data scraping speed so you’re not just gathering information effectively, but efficiently too.
Handling Yelp’s Anti-Scraping Measures
Handling Yelp’s anti-scraping measures can be tricky, but it’s certainly not impossible for you.
- You’ve got to understand that Yelp uses sophisticated algorithms to detect and block suspicious activities. So, make sure your scraping activity mimics human behavior as much as possible.
- Rotate your IP addresses frequently using proxies. This ensures that you aren’t easily detected or blocked.
- Stay within Yelp’s terms of service and respect their robots.txt file. Breaching these could lead to legal consequences.
Remember, patience is key here. It might take a bit more time than expected, but the results are worth it.
Optimizing Data Scraping Speed
Optimizing your extraction speed isn’t just about going faster. It’s about being more efficient and avoiding unnecessary roadblocks. You’ve got to understand that there’s a delicate balance between speed and accuracy when scraping data from sites like Yelp.
Too fast, and you risk tripping anti-scraping measures or missing valuable information. Too slow, and you’ll waste precious time.
Now, here’s the good news: using proxies can significantly improve your scraping efficiency. They allow you to distribute requests over numerous IP addresses, reducing the chances of being blocked while accelerating your data extraction process.
However, don’t forget to rotate these proxies regularly to keep them effective. In essence, it’s all a game of smart strategies and mindful execution for optimal results.
Ensuring Anonymity With Proxies While Scraping Yelp
It’s crucial to maintain anonymity using proxies when scraping Yelp to avoid detection and potential bans. You know what they say, ‘Better safe than sorry.’
Now, let me share with you three reasons why this matters:
- Peace of Mind: No one wants a ban hammer hanging over their head every time they’re collecting data.
- Consistency: Bans can interrupt your workflow, causing inconsistencies in your scraped data.
- Reputation: If you’re found out and banned, it could harm your reputation as a responsible data scraper.
How to Choose the Right Proxies for Your Yelp Scraper
In the quest to choose the right proxies for your Yelp scraper, you must be able to differentiate between proxy types. You’ve got to consider not only their speed and stability but also how much bang you’re getting for your buck in terms of quality.
ProxyEmpire delivers over 9 million continuously changing residential proxies which are procured ethically, and come with advanced filtering capabilities enabling you to target specific countries, regions, cities, and ISPs.
Each residential proxy package includes exceptional VIP integration support that can have you up and running in no time. ProxyEmpire caters to a range of usage scenarios that other proxy providers simply do not support.
Our residential proxies are compatible with all common proxy protocols, making certain they can integrate seamlessly with whatever software stack you are using.
Additionally, we offer static residential proxies or ISP proxies, which give you the option of utilizing the same IP address for a month or more.
ProxyEmpire provides a robust network of mobile proxies that perform exceptionally well with APP-only platforms.
Explore new avenues of data collection specific to mobile and stay under the radar when making requests.
Our rotating mobile proxies promise the best possible connection, and ProxyEmpire offers them across more than 170 countries. You can even filter down to the mobile carrier level.
We also offer dedicated mobile proxies with no bandwidth restrictions, giving you full control over IP changes while enjoying the fastest proxy speeds.
ProxyEmpire stands out as the only backconnect proxy partner that offers rollover data. Consequently, any unused data from a month can be carried over to the next.
Experience limitless concurrent connections across any GEO location without experiencing throttling or IP blocking.
Our solid rotating proxy network guarantees a 99.86% uptime. Every IP address undergoes rigorous quality testing to ensure you only receive the best rotating proxies.
Discover How Our Proxies Are Being Utilized by Clients;
Proxy Types Comparison
When scraping data from Yelp, you’ll find a stark difference in performance between residential, mobile, and data center proxies. Each type has its own set of strengths and weaknesses that are worth considering:
- Residential Proxies: You’re using real IP addresses from ISPs which makes your requests appear more legitimate. However, they can be pricey.
- Mobile Proxies: These rotate IPs frequently, offering increased anonymity but can suffer from slower speeds due to network fluctuations.
- Data Center Proxies: Known for their fast speed and affordability, but they don’t provide the best level of anonymity.
Consider Speed and Stability
You’ll need to weigh up speed and stability, as these factors can significantly influence your overall efficiency. Quick proxies might seem appealing, but if they’re unstable, they’re not worth the hassle. You’ll spend more time troubleshooting than data scraping from Yelp.
Conversely, stable proxies might be slower but provide consistent results without interruptions or unexpected errors. So it’s a bit of a trade-off you’ve got to consider.
It’s also vital to remember that some providers offer both high-speed and high-stability proxies, but they often come with a higher price tag. It’d be best if you balanced out your budget against your desire for speed and reliability.
Price and Proxy Quality
Considering the price against quality can be a bit of a balancing act, but it’s one that you’ve got to tackle head-on. When selecting proxies for Yelp scraping, you have to weigh the cost and the performance of the proxy.
- Cheap but Unreliable: You might feel drawn towards low-priced options – they’re tempting! But remember, they often come with instability issues which could jeopardize your data scraping efforts.
- Expensive yet Robust: Higher-priced proxies might strike fear into your budgeting heart, but their superior reliability and speed could prove invaluable in ensuring a smooth scraping process.
- Balanced Choice: The ultimate goal is finding that sweet spot – affordable proxies with dependable quality. It’ll make your wallet sigh with relief and keep your operations running smoothly.
The Role of IP Rotation in Yelp Data Scraping
To effectively scrape data from Yelp without getting blocked, you’ll need to understand the role of IP rotation. It’s a method used to avoid detection by switching between different IP addresses.
When you’re scraping Yelp, they monitor your activities and if they find any suspicious behavior like multiple requests from a single IP, they’ll block it.
IP rotation is essential because it ensures that you don’t overuse one specific IP when scraping data. This way, Yelp can’t easily identify and block your scraping attempts.
You should use proxies for this purpose as they provide you with numerous IPs to rotate through. Using high-quality proxies will enhance your chances of successful data extraction by reducing the likelihood of getting detected or blocked by Yelp’s security systems.
Tips for Efficient and Effective Data Scraping on Yelp
It’s crucial to follow certain guidelines for efficient and effective information extraction from online platforms. Yelp is no exception. Scraping data from Yelp can be challenging, but your task can be simplified if you:
- Use a reliable proxy service: This helps maintain anonymity and reduces the risk of getting blocked.
- Implement an IP rotation system: By changing IPs frequently, you’ll evade detection while scraping large amounts of data.
- Follow Yelp’s robots.txt file: This will ensure you are not breaching any legalities.
Can I Use the Same Proxies to Scrape Data From Other Platforms Besides Yelp?
You can use the same proxies to scrape data from other platforms besides Yelp. However, it’s important to understand that each platform has its own rules and policies regarding data scraping.
Always ensure you’re adhering to these guidelines. Also, be mindful of your proxy’s capacity as different sites may require varying levels of bandwidth and speed.
It’s all about finding a balance between your needs and the constraints of your tools.
How Often Do I Need to Update or Change My Proxies for Effective Yelp Data Scraping?
You’ll want to update or change your proxies regularly for effective Yelp data scraping. How often depends on several factors, including the frequency of your scraping and Yelp’s IP tracking methods.
It’s a good rule of thumb to rotate them every few weeks, but if you’re noticing a lot of blocked requests, you may need to do it more frequently.
Keep track of your successes and failures to find the optimal rotation schedule.
Are There Free Proxies Available That Can Be Used Effectively for Yelp Data Scraping?
You’re asking if there are free proxies that can be effectively used for data scraping. Yes, they exist but they aren’t always reliable or secure.
They might work briefly but could fail when you need them most. Also, free proxies usually have more users which can lead to slower speeds.
It’s often worth investing in paid proxies to ensure consistency, speed, and security while scraping data.
Can the Use of Proxies Guarantee 100% Success in Data Scraping From Yelp?
While using proxies can boost your chances of successful data scraping from Yelp, they don’t guarantee a 100% success rate. You’re bypassing restrictions and avoiding IP bans, but Yelp’s anti-scraping measures are robust.
It’s essential to use proper scraping etiquette, like rotating proxies and maintaining reasonable request rates. Remember, even with precautions, there’s always a risk when you’re working against a site’s terms of service.
In conclusion, you are now equipped with valuable knowledge about Yelp data scraping and the crucial role that proxies play in it. Use this newly acquired understanding to select the most suitable proxies and implement effective IP rotation for successful results. Don’t avoid confronting challenges and keep in mind all the tips offered in this guide to enhance your data scraping process on Yelp.
Speaking about ProxyEmpire, this platform offers a wide variety of proxies including rotating residential proxies, static residential proxies, rotating mobile proxies, and 5G mobile proxies to suit various needs. With over 9 million constantly changing residential proxies and an extensive network of mobile proxies, they ensure you robust, fast, and secure data scraping. ProxyEmpire’s dedicated support, state-of-the-art filtering capabilities, and the offer of piped data place it a step ahead of other proxy providers. With ProxyEmpire, you will not just be scraping data efficiently, but also safer and faster. Happy scraping with ProxyEmpire!